The Top Small Business Modifications to Watch Out for in NYS in 2022

The pandemic has significantly impacted small businesses across the United States, and entrepreneurs have been forced to adapt to survive. In 2022, New York State-based businesses will face new challenges that will require strategic modifications to stay relevant and profitable.

Here are some of the top small business modifications to watch out for in NYS in 2022:

1. Remote Work Policies

The pandemic has shown that it is possible to work remotely without sacrificing productivity. Many businesses have adopted remote work policies to promote flexibility and employee satisfaction. In 2022, small businesses in NYS may need to create, implement, and enforce remote work policies to stay competitive in the talent market.

2. Online Presence

In today’s digital age, small businesses must have a strong online presence to reach more customers. This includes having a professional website, active social media accounts, and email marketing campaigns. Small businesses in NYS must prioritize building and maintaining their online presence to increase their visibility and attract more customers.

3. Flexible Payment Options

Small businesses must be able to accommodate varying payment preferences from customers. Offering flexible payment options such as mobile payment or buy-now-pay-later services can improve customer satisfaction, increase sales, and keep up with changing payment trends.

4. Sustainability

Consumers are becoming increasingly conscious about the impact of their purchases on the environment. Small businesses must adopt sustainable practices, such as reducing waste, using eco-friendly products, and sourcing locally, to meet customer demands and remain competitive.

5. Service Delivery

The shift towards online shopping and delivery services is here to stay. Small businesses must adapt their service delivery options to meet customer needs and preferences. This could mean offering curbside pickup, same-day delivery, or partnering with third-party delivery companies.

In conclusion, small businesses in NYS must be prepared to make modifications in 2022 to stay relevant and competitive. By prioritizing remote work policies, building their online presence, offering flexible payment options, adopting sustainable practices, and adapting their service delivery options to meet customer needs, small businesses can thrive even in challenging times.
